About 200 members of the Boys Club Network of British Columbia organized a fundraising walk in West Vancouver. The walk symbolized the journey that refugees from Syria make as they flee that war-torn country. The Boys Club Network pairs at-risk teens with mentors to lift the boys up and restore their personal accountability and their confidence in themselves and in society’s collective future. These youth were inspired when Boys Club Network patron and Radcliffe Foundation founder Frank Giustra spoke about the refugee crisis at a number of Vancouver-area schools.
